"System.NotSupportedException: .Net Framework에서 지원하지 않는 문자 세트 'utf8mb3'" 뒤에 숨겨진 수수께끼 공개
MySQL 데이터베이스는 종종 복잡한 문제에 직면합니다 이러한 수수께끼 같은 오류 중 하나는 "System.NotSupportedException: 문자 세트 'utf8mb3'은 .Net Framework에서 지원되지 않습니다."입니다.
문제 조사
이 오류 메시지는 .Net Framework가 MySQL 데이터베이스에서 사용하는 문자 집합 'utf8mb3'을 처리할 수 없을 때 나타납니다. 증가된 저장 용량과 효율성을 위해 설계된 이 문자 집합은 .Net Framework와의 호환성 문제를 제기합니다.
솔루션 공개
이 수수께끼의 딜레마에 대한 해결책은 다음에 있습니다. MySQL 커넥터/NET을 업데이트합니다. 버전 8.0.28 이상(NuGet 패키지 MySql.Data로 사용 가능)으로 업그레이드하면 사용자는 데이터베이스 문자 집합과 .Net Framework 간의 호환성 격차를 효과적으로 메울 수 있습니다.
이 간단한 소프트웨어 업데이트는 기적적으로 복원합니다. 적절한 데이터베이스 연결을 통해 "문자 세트 'utf8mb3'은 .Net Framework에서 지원되지 않습니다." 오류를 제거하고 개발자가 방해 없이 코딩 작업을 진행할 수 있습니다.
위 내용은 .Net Framework에서 \"System.NotSupportedException: 문자 세트 \'utf8mb3\' 지원되지 않음\"이 발생하는 이유는 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!